我想添加按钮,让用户倒退30秒时,在mp3播放器收听歌曲,但见鬼我做不到。我已经玩了几个小时了,下面是我使用的。我已经拥有的东西
返回30秒的代码
// jump 30 seconds back when we click the button
$('.audioplayer-back30s').click(function(){
var audio = $('audio');
var backToSec = audio.currentTime - 30;
// make sure that we jump to a va
当我的html5视频播放器达到某个时间时,我想显示()一个div。我能够让div显示在视频的末尾,但我不确定当视频在特定时间,如0:06时,如何显示div。
<div id = "showdiv" style="display:none" align="center">
this is the message that will pop up.
</div>
<video id='myVideo' align="center" margin-top="100p
如何配置popcorn.js以在每次视频更新时发出事件?那么,我应该只使用视频元素的时间更新事件吗?
目前,我只能在特定的启动时间设置事件:
var p = Popcorn( "#video" )
// play the video
.play()
// set the volume to zero
.volume( 0 )
.code({
start: 1,
end: 3,
onStart: function( options ) {
如果这段代码在index.html的脚本标记中,它可以正常工作,但是当将这段代码移到头部引用的js文件中时,它就不再起作用了。我的一个想法是使用window.onload,但无法使其正常工作。这是一个简单的本地HTML5视频播放器。我已经有一段时间没有使用外部js了。有人能帮我吗? var myVideo = document.getElementById("myVideo");
function playPause() {
var el = document.getElementById("playButton");
if (myVideo.pau
我正在使用Popcorn.js制作一个交互式视频,但我对JavaScript还很陌生。我正在尝试循环视频中的特定部分。我尝试了一个if语句,当当前时间达到时,当前时间将被后退。不幸的是,这不起作用。
function loop() {
var video = document.getElementById('video');
if (video.currentTime = 82)
{
(video.currentTime = 77)
}
}
你们中有没有人有建议/解决方案?
我有两个功能,发挥相同的视频,但与不同的时间。我不能发挥使其正常工作的作用。
看起来这个函数没有重置另一个函数
我试图更改变量名,但仍然更改了单击的时间。
var video = document.getElementById('videoElm');
function playShortVideo() {
var starttime = 0; // start at 0 seconds
var endtime = 2; // stop at 2 seconds
video.addEventListener("timeupdate", func
我正在开发一个页面,其中我必须显示与其相关的pdf视频。我分别使用pdf.js和video.js项目来阅读pdf和视频。它们都是在不同的div中实现的。这是我的页面截图的链接 .I需要实现一个功能,它检查视频的当前时间并根据时间改变pdf div的位置以下是我实现的代码,但它根本不起作用
//function to perform on every timeupdate
var myFunc =function(){
var myPlayer = this;
var whereYouAt = myPlayer.currentTime();
//working of functi
我不能让视频在2秒后循环。它应该在视频暂停后循环。我不确定这会不会发生。该功能运行良好,但不会循环。 function playVideo() {
var starttime = 0; // start at 0 seconds
var endtime = 2; // stop at 2 seconds
var video = document.getElementById('videoElm');
video.addEventListener("timeupdate", function() {
if (this.current
我有jquery倒计时函数,代码如下:
$.fn.countdown = function(toTime, callback){
let $el = $(this);
var intervalId;
let timeUpdate = () => {
var now = new Date().getTime();
var dista